用于半导体集成电路的调试系统技术方案

技术编号:3215268 阅读:138 留言:0更新日期:2012-04-11 18:40
采用多个结构与受到调试的LSI(大规模集成电路)相同的半导体集成电路,以此,分别从处于相同工作条件下的这些集成电路中采集不同的内部信号,其中根据所采集的内部信号来分析LSI的工作。通过这样做,就不需要添加LSI的输出端子或者每隔一段时间就切换从输出端子输出的内部信号。这实现了以低成本和简单配置来调试整个LSI。(*该技术在2022年保护过期,可自由使用*)

【技术实现步骤摘要】
本申请涉及2001年5月18日提交的日本特许公报No.2001-149977和2002年3月6日提交的日本特许公报No.2002-059998,基于该特许公报,根据巴黎公约本申请要求优先权,并将该特许公报的内容通过引用合并于此。但是,在增加LSI的输出端子、以便尽可能多地观察内部信号的情况下,LSI可能具有复杂的结构和大的体积,还可能变得昂贵。为了克服这类问题,可以考虑每隔一段时间就切换从输出端子输出的内部信号,因此无法同时观察多个内部信号,使得内部信号之间的相关性不可分析,导致不能精确地执行整个LSI的调试。在本专利技术中,采用多个具有与受到调试的半导体集成电路相同结构的半导体集成电路,以此,在同样的工作条件下,从那些半导体集成电路中分别采集不同的内部信号,其中采集与所连接的半导体集成电路的数目成比例的内部信号,并且根据采集的内部信号来分析所述半导体集成电路的工作。根据这种配置,没有必要添加半导体集成电路的输出端子或者每隔一段时间切换从输出端子输出的内部信号,从而实现整个半导体集成电路的调试而不增加其成本。还有可能连接三个或三个以上的半导体集成电路,其中,在那些电路中的两个或两个以上电路处于相同工作条件下的同时,从各个半导体集成电路中采集全然不同的内部信号。也有可能在相同工作条件下连接三个或三个以上半导体集成电路,从这些连接的半导体集成电路中的两个或两个以上电路中采集全然不同的内部信号。还有可能连接三个或三个以上的半导体集成电路,其中,监视这些电路中的一个电路的工作条件,并且从两个或两个以上半导体集成电路中采集全然不同的内部信号,使得除被监视的半导体集成电路以外的半导体集成电路的工作条件与被监视的半导体集成电路的工作条件相同。一旦理解了将要联系附图来描述的说明性实施例,本专利技术的其他和进一步的目的和特点会变得显而易见,或者会在所附书中被指出,而一旦在实际应用中采用本专利技术,本领域的技术人员会想到各种这里未提到的优点。附图说明图1是说明根据本专利技术的实施例的调试系统的整个结构的简化示意图;图2是表示图1中的调试系统内的LSI的外观的简化示意图;图3是表示图2中LSI的内部结构的简化示意图;以及图4是表示调试系统的操作的流程图。本专利技术可用于调试系统,它观察和分析图1所示的LSI的内部信号。调试系统的结构参考图1描述根据本专利技术的实施例的调试系统的整个结构。如图1所示,这样配置本实施例的调试系统,使得调试专用板4经插接单元1电连接到板2内的LSI3,调试所述板2。LSI3还连接到板2中的其他电路块5。调试专用板4经电线连接到计算机系统6,并且其中设有多个结构与LSI3相同的LSI(下文称为调试LSI以便与LSI3区别)。LSI3的输出端子和调试LSI的输出端子通过电线7与相应的端子互相连接。应当理解,在本实施例中,调试专用板4中设有四个调试LSI,但是,本专利技术不限于这个数目,其中还有可能根据要观察的内部信号的数目添加或减少调试LSI。接着,参考图2和3描述LSI 3的结构(=调试LSI)。如图2所示,LSI3具有多个内部信号输出端子8、多个选择器端子9以及多个常规输出端子10。而且,常规输出端子10经插接单元1与调试LSI的各端子连接。如图3所示,在LSI3内,除用于实现LSI的各种功能的电路块12以外,还设置了解码器11、选择器13、“与”电路14和缓冲器电路15。常规输出端子10仅在输入选择器端子9中的信号图形是特定的一种时,执行常规操作(输出内部信号),在除所述特定的一种以外的信号图形的情况下,禁止所述常规输出端子10输出内部信号。调试系统的操作下面参考图4来描述利用上述调试系统对LSI3的调试处理。图4的流程图中所示的处理以此开始,即调试处理的执行者(下文称为操作者)通过插接单元1把LSI3与调试专用板4连接,此时,调试处理进行到步骤S1。在步骤S1,操作者直接地或通过计算机系统6向LSI3的选择器端子9输入信号图形,该图形表明允许从常规输出端子10输出。这使LSI3能执行常规操作,并且从LSI3的常规输出端子输出内部信号。这完成了步骤S1的处理,于是,调试处理从步骤S1进行到步骤S2。在步骤S2中,操作者通过操作计算机系统6,指定要输入各个调试LSI的选择器端子9的信号图形,例如,高电平/低电平。更具体地说,操作者指定对于各个调试LSI都不相同的信号图形。例如,当操作者在一个调试LSI中输入高电平/低电平的信号图形时,操作者在另一个调试LSI中输入低电平/高电平的不同信号图形。通过这样做,从各个调试LSI的内部信号输出端子输出对于各个调试LSI都不相同的内部信号。应当指出,操作者不给调试LSI的选择器端子9指定这种指示允许常规输出端子10输出的信号图形(在上述示例情况中,例如为高电平/高电平)。通过这样做,不从调试LSI的常规输出端子10输出内部信号,但是,从LSI3的常规输出端子10输出内部信号,而且信号被发送到调试LSI的相应的常规输出端子10,使得调试LSI表面上执行常规操作。这完成步骤S2的处理,于是,调试处理从步骤S2进行到步骤S3。在步骤S3,操作者指示执行对LSI3的调试处理。根据该指示,计算机系统6把操作者在步骤S2中指定的信号图形输出到调试LSI的选择器端子9。这完成步骤S3的处理,此时,调试处理从步骤S3进行到步骤S4。在步骤S4,各个调试LSI中的解码器11根据计算机系统6输入调试LSI的选择器端子9中的信号图形,产生选择信号,以便指定用于选择性输出的电路块12的内部信号。这完成步骤S4的处理,此时,调试处理从步骤S4进行到步骤S5。在步骤S5,各个调试LSI中的解码器11产生输出禁止信号,该信号禁止从调试LSI的常规输出端子10输出,然后向“与”电路14输出所述输出禁止信号。这使常规输出端子10不输出电路块12的内部信号,此时,调试处理从步骤S5进行到步骤S6。在步骤S6中,各个调试LSI中的选择器13根据解码器11所产生的选择信号,选择电路块12的内部信号并将其输出到内部信号输出端子8。此外,响应解码器11产生的输出禁止信号,“与”电路操作缓冲器电路15,后者控制常规输出端子10的输出,以便禁止从常规输出端子10输出。这完成步骤S6的处理,此时,调试处理从步骤S6进行到步骤S7。在步骤S7,操作者利用计算机系统6观察从各个调试LSI的内部信号输出端子8输出的内部信号,并且利用工具、如定时分析程序来分析LSI3的硬件或软件中存在的问题或错误(缺陷)。这完成步骤S7的处理,此时,调试处理从步骤S7进行到步骤S8。在步骤S8,根据分析结果,操作者确定LSI3的硬件或软件内的缺陷或错误。这就完成了一系列的调试处理。如从前面的详细描述中明白的,在根据本实施例的调试系统中,因为内部信号是从连接到LSI3的多个调试LSI收集的,所以不需要添加LSI3的输出端子来用于收集内部信号,也不需要每隔一段时间切换从输出端子输出的内部信号。这实现了以低成本和简单配置来调试整个LSI。此外,在本实施例的调试系统中,可以同时从与LSI3处于同样的工作条件下的调试LSI收集都互不相同的内部信号,从而使操作者可以观察内部信号之间的相关,并且高精确地执行整个LSI的调试处理。其他实施例前述是对本专利技术人本文档来自技高网...

【技术保护点】
一种调试系统,它包括:用于调试的板,该板具有多个半导体集成电路,这些集成电路与受到调试的半导体集成电路的结构相同;以及分析装置,用于从所述板内的各个半导体集成电路采集不同的内部信号,而这些半导体集成电路处于相同的工作条件下,并且用于 根据所述采集的内部信号来分析半导体集成电路的工作。

【技术特征摘要】
JP 2001-5-18 149977/01;JP 2002-3-6 59998/021.一种调试系统,它包括用于调试的板,该板具有多个半导体集成电路,这些集成电路与受到调试的半导体集成电路的结构相同;以及分析装置,用于从所述板内的各个半导体集成电路采集不同的内部信号,而这些半导体集成电路处于相同的工作条件下,并且用于根据所述采集的内部信号来分析半导体集成电路的工作。2.如权利要求1所述的调试系统,其特征在于所述半导体集成电路具有选择输出端子,用于根据所述分析装置输入的信号图形来选择性地输出所述半导体集成电路的所述内部信号。3.如权利要求2所述的调试系统,其特征在于仅仅在所述分析装置输入预定信号图形时,所述半导体集成电路的除所述选择输出端子以外的输出端子才输出所述内部信号。4.如权利要求3所述的调试系统,其特征在于所述半导体集成电路的所述输出端子连接到所述板内的其他半导体集成电路的相应的输出端子,并且所述预定的信号图形被输入到所述多个半导体集成电路中的至少一个集成电路中。5.一种半导体集成电路,它包括多个第一端子,用于输入指定要采集的内部信号的信号图形;多个第二端子,用于根据输入所述第一端子的所述信号图形、选择性地输出所述内部信号;以及多个第三端子,用于仅仅当预定信号图形被输入到所述第一端子中时、输出所述内部信号。6.如权利要求5所述的半导体集成电路,其特征在于还包括解码器,用于对输入所述第一端子中的所述信号图形进行解码,并且产生选择器信号来指定要从所述第二端子输出的内部信号;以及选择器,用于根据所述选择器信号、选择要从所述第二端子输出的内部信号。7.一种半导体集成电路的调试方法,它包括以下步骤在用于调试的板内的多个半导体集成电路中,输入指定要收集的内部信号的信号图形,所述多个半导体集成电路与受到调试的半导体集成电路的结构相同;响应所述信号图形,从所述板内的所述各个半导体集成电路的预定输出端采集所...

【专利技术属性】
技术研发人员:菅原彰彦
申请(专利权)人:索尼电脑娱乐公司
类型:发明
国别省市:JP[日本]

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1
相关领域技术
  • 暂无相关专利